In modern usage, therefore, an algorithm is ''non-blocking'' if the suspension of one or more threads will not stop the potential progress of the remaining threads. They are designed to avoid requiring a [[critical section]]. Often, these algorithms allow multiple processes to make progress on a problem without ever blocking each other. For some operations, these algorithms provide an alternative to [[locking mechanism]]s.
